liquid_feedback_frontend
changeset 312:5e6bdf07e3a1
Some color and positioning changes again...
| author | bsw | 
|---|---|
| date | Mon Feb 27 16:19:11 2012 +0100 (2012-02-27) | 
| parents | b3506522d043 | 
| children | 56dc44366c38 | 
| files | app/main/initiative/_list_element.lua app/main/issue/_list.lua static/style.css | 
   line diff
1.1 --- a/app/main/initiative/_list_element.lua Mon Feb 27 16:18:56 2012 +0100 1.2 +++ b/app/main/initiative/_list_element.lua Mon Feb 27 16:19:11 2012 +0100 1.3 @@ -37,7 +37,7 @@ 1.4 }, 1.5 1.6 { 1.7 - field_attr = { style = "width: 110px;"}, 1.8 + field_attr = { style = "width: 100px;"}, 1.9 content = function() 1.10 if initiative.issue.fully_frozen and initiative.issue.closed then 1.11 if initiative.issue.ranks_available then 1.12 @@ -74,7 +74,41 @@ 1.13 end 1.14 end 1.15 }, 1.16 + { 1.17 + field_attr = { style = "width: 24px;" }, 1.18 + content = function() 1.19 + if initiative.is_initiator then 1.20 + slot.put(" ") 1.21 + local label = _"You are initiator of this initiative" 1.22 + ui.image{ 1.23 + attr = { alt = label, title = label }, 1.24 + static = "icons/16/user_edit.png" 1.25 + } 1.26 + elseif initiative.is_supporter then 1.27 + slot.put(" ") 1.28 + local label = _"You are supporter of this initiative" 1.29 + ui.image{ 1.30 + attr = { alt = label, title = label }, 1.31 + static = "icons/16/thumb_up_green.png" 1.32 + } 1.33 + elseif initiative.is_potential_supporter then 1.34 + slot.put(" ") 1.35 + local label = _"You are potentially supporter of this initiative" 1.36 + ui.image{ 1.37 + attr = { alt = label, title = label }, 1.38 + static = "icons/16/thumb_up.png" 1.39 + } 1.40 + elseif initiative.is_supporter_via_delegation then 1.41 + slot.put(" ") 1.42 + local label = _"You are supporter of this initiative via delegation" 1.43 + ui.image{ 1.44 + attr = { alt = label, title = label }, 1.45 + static = "icons/16/thumb_up_green.png" 1.46 + } 1.47 + end 1.48 1.49 + end 1.50 + }, 1.51 { 1.52 content = function() 1.53 local link_class = "initiative_link" 1.54 @@ -111,33 +145,6 @@ 1.55 params = params, 1.56 } 1.57 1.58 - if initiative.is_supporter then 1.59 - slot.put(" ") 1.60 - local label = _"You are supporter of this initiative" 1.61 - ui.image{ 1.62 - attr = { alt = label, title = label }, 1.63 - static = "icons/16/thumb_up_green.png" 1.64 - } 1.65 - end 1.66 - 1.67 - if initiative.is_supporter_via_delegation then 1.68 - slot.put(" ") 1.69 - local label = _"You are supporter of this initiative via delegation" 1.70 - ui.image{ 1.71 - attr = { alt = label, title = label }, 1.72 - static = "icons/16/thumb_up_green.png" 1.73 - } 1.74 - end 1.75 - 1.76 - if initiative.is_initiator then 1.77 - slot.put(" ") 1.78 - local label = _"You are initiator of this initiative" 1.79 - ui.image{ 1.80 - attr = { alt = label, title = label }, 1.81 - static = "icons/16/user_edit.png" 1.82 - } 1.83 - end 1.84 - 1.85 end 1.86 } 1.87 }
2.1 --- a/app/main/issue/_list.lua Mon Feb 27 16:18:56 2012 +0100 2.2 +++ b/app/main/issue/_list.lua Mon Feb 27 16:19:11 2012 +0100 2.3 @@ -44,7 +44,16 @@ 2.4 2.5 ui.container{ attr = { class = "issue_info" }, content = function() 2.6 2.7 - if issue.is_interested_by_delegation_to_member_id then 2.8 + if issue.is_interested then 2.9 + ui.tag{ 2.10 + tag = "div", attr = { class = "interest_by_delegation"}, 2.11 + content = function() 2.12 + local text = "You are interested in this issue" 2.13 + ui.image{ attr = { alt = text, title = text }, static = "icons/16/eye.png" } 2.14 + end 2.15 + } 2.16 + 2.17 + elseif issue.is_interested_by_delegation_to_member_id then 2.18 ui.tag{ 2.19 tag = "div", attr = { class = "interest_by_delegation"}, 2.20 content = function()
3.1 --- a/static/style.css Mon Feb 27 16:18:56 2012 +0100 3.2 +++ b/static/style.css Mon Feb 27 16:19:11 2012 +0100 3.3 @@ -201,7 +201,7 @@ 3.4 .title { 3.5 background-color: #ddd; 3.6 background: -webkit-gradient(linear, left top, left bottom, 3.7 - color-stop(15%,#ddd), color-stop(100%,#fff) 3.8 + color-stop(15%,#ddd), color-stop(50%,#fff) 3.9 ); 3.10 text-shadow: #fff 0px 0px 3px; 3.11 color: #000; 3.12 @@ -224,13 +224,18 @@ 3.13 } 3.14 3.15 .slot_title2 { 3.16 - margin-top: 1ex; 3.17 - margin-left: 1em; 3.18 + padding: 1ex 1em 0 1em; 3.19 } 3.20 3.21 .initiatives_list { 3.22 clear: left; 3.23 - margin-bottom: 1ex; 3.24 +} 3.25 + 3.26 +.slot_initiatives_list { 3.27 + border-top: 1px solid #aaa; 3.28 + border-bottom: 1px solid #aaa; 3.29 + padding-top: 1ex; 3.30 + padding-bottom: 1ex; 3.31 } 3.32 3.33 .member_list .member_image_avatar { 3.34 @@ -270,9 +275,8 @@ 3.35 .slot_initiative_head { 3.36 background: -webkit-gradient(linear, left top, left bottom, 3.37 color-stop(0%,#e7e7e7), color-stop(66%,#fff)); 3.38 - margin-top: 2ex; 3.39 padding-left: 1em; 3.40 - padding-top: 2ex; 3.41 + padding-top: 1ex; 3.42 text-shadow: #fff 0px 0px 3px; 3.43 } 3.44 3.45 @@ -865,12 +869,12 @@ 3.46 font-weight: bold; 3.47 } 3.48 3.49 -.initiative_link.supported { 3.50 +x.initiative_link.supported { 3.51 background-color: #cdf; 3.52 border-radius: 5px; 3.53 } 3.54 3.55 -.initiative_link.potentially_supported { 3.56 +x.initiative_link.potentially_supported { 3.57 background-color: #cdf; 3.58 border-radius: 5px; 3.59 } 3.60 @@ -1054,7 +1058,9 @@ 3.61 .revoked_info { 3.62 background-color: #fdd; 3.63 padding: 1ex; 3.64 + margin-top: 2ex; 3.65 margin-bottom: 2ex; 3.66 + border-radius: 8px; 3.67 } 3.68 3.69 .draft_updated_info,